New Handlebar day! by dedenby in Surlybikefans

[–]dedenby[S] 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Definitely a bit more upright vs the stock flat bars. The sweep provides what to me feels like a more natural grip angle with the wrists. Haven't taken it on a long ride yet, but even just puttering around it feels like less pressure on my hands. I need to pick up some bar tape, see what I can do about setting up some alternative grip positions. I'm curious how it's gonna feel on big uphills.

What the heck is this thing? by pokerbrowni in Machinists

[–]dedenby 2 points3 points  (0 children)

It's unscrewed. This type of tool often has a replaceable tip.

What the heck is this thing? by pokerbrowni in Machinists

[–]dedenby 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I use tools like that in the shop I work at. Typically Walter and Sandvik roughing endmills, 2" and 2.5" diameter, CAT50 taper. These things are beasts. We make industrial demolition and recycling tools out of wear plate steel.
